Assembly seat dispute: Appeal Court awards costs against lawmaker


Justice Ahmad Belgore of the Court of Appeal in Ado-Ekiti, yesterday, penalised a Member of the Ekiti State House of Assembly, Musa Arogundade, by awarding a N10, 000 cost against him for delay in compiling and transmitting supplementary record of appeal within the time allowed by law.
Arogundade is appealing a judgment of a Federal High Court, Ado-Ekiti, which nullified his election and declared Toyin Obayemi as the validly elected lawmaker to represent Ado-Ekiti Constituency 1 in the assembly.
Aside nullifying his election, the Federal High Court had also ordered the lawmaker to refund all salaries, allowances and emoluments received since he was inaugurated as a lawmaker in June 2015.
Belgore also ordered the lawmaker and the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) to file a motion to consolidate their appeals.
All pending applications were taken, while the court also ordered the appellants to file their brief of argument on or before June 19.
The court adjourned the case to June 19 for hearing and adoption of brief of argument.
